shower mat for quadrant showerThe primary benefit of slipping mats is their ability to enhance safety in the workplace. According to statistics, slips, trips, and falls account for a significant number of workplace injuries, leading to lost time and increased insurance claims. By placing slipping mats in high-risk areas—such as entryways, kitchens, and near machinery—employers can significantly reduce the incidence of accidents. These mats provide a textured surface that increases grip, effectively reducing the chances of slipping, even in wet or greasy conditions.

Drafts under doors can be a nuisance, allowing cold air to seep into your home during the winter months and warm air to escape during the summer. One solution to this problem is a seal strip door stopper, a simple yet effective tool that can help keep your home more comfortable and energy efficient.

Car window rubber seal strips are an essential component of any vehicle, providing a tight seal between the car's windows and body to prevent water, dust, and noise from entering the interior. These rubber strips play a crucial role in maintaining the overall integrity of the car's structure and ensuring a comfortable driving experience for passengers.

Casting slurry pump parts are designed to withstand the rigors of handling abrasive materials, but they too require careful monitoring and timely replacement. The quality of the casting, the material used, and the operating conditions all influence the wear rate of these parts. By selecting high-quality casting slurry pump parts and implementing a regular inspection routine, you can better manage wear and optimize the replacement cycle. This approach ensures that your pump continues to operate efficiently, even in demanding environments, and helps to avoid costly breakdowns.

slurry pump wet end partsSPR slurry pumps are specifically designed for handling slurry in applications where high liquid levels are a concern. These pumps are engineered to operate efficiently in environments where the pump must remain submerged for extended periods. The vertical design of SPR slurry pumps allows them to function effectively in deep pits and sumps, where other pump types might struggle. By optimizing the design to handle high liquid levels, SPR slurry pumps provide reliable performance in challenging conditions, ensuring that slurry is effectively managed and transported, even in the most demanding deep pit applications.

Moreover, the volute's cross-sectional area is carefully calculated to match the flow rate and pressure requirements of the system. An oversized volute may lead to low efficiency, as the fluid may not maintain its velocity to generate adequate pressure. Conversely, a volute that is too small can cause excessive pressure buildup, risking damage to the pump and downstream equipment.

In agriculture, propeller pumps are commonly employed for irrigation purposes. With the ever-increasing need for food production and sustainable practices, farmers often rely on these pumps to distribute water from reservoirs or rivers to their fields. The efficiency and reliability of propeller pumps allow for optimal irrigation strategies, which are vital in maintaining crop health and maximizing yield. Moreover, they can operate in varying conditions, making them suitable for diverse agricultural environments.
